    Unbound. Condition: Near Fine. Vintage gelatin silver sepia-toned photograph. Measuring 5 by 3 3/4 inches. The image depicts Ruth McEnery Stuart, seated at a table, with one arm resting on an open book. The image is marked by Campbell Studios, Waldorf Astoria, possibly photographed by Rudolf Eickemeyer, Jr. who took photographs for Campbell Studios from 1909 until 1915, in their studio in the Waldorf Astoria Hotel (for more information, please see the online exhibition "Broadway Photographs: Art Photography & the American Stage 1900-1930"). Faint crease and small chip at upper right corner barely affecting the image, else very good, with sharp focus. Ruth McEnery Stuart, a southern writer, was born in Marksville, Louisiana. She is perhaps best remembered for her dialect writing, and "sympathetic treatment of Negro folkways" ['Notable American Women,' Vol. III, p. 407]. Captioned on verso in an unknown hand: "Mrs. Ruth McEnery Stuart, author of 'Daddy Do Funny.".
